Biography

Abid Khan is an Associate Professor at the University of Chicago in the Department of Surgery-Trauma Acute Care. His research focuses on various medical subjects, particularly those related to brain injuries, pharmaceuticals like hydroxybenzoates and paroxetine, as well as the utilization of liposomes and antioxidants in therapeutic contexts. Khan has published numerous works that delve into these topics, indicating a strong dedication to advancing the field of surgery and trauma care.
